On Tuesday, March 11, former Butler Area Senior High School standout Madden Clement’s current college team, the Virginia Tech Hokies, won 5-4 in their NCAA Division I baseball game against the James Madison Dukes.

The game took place at Eagle Field at Veterans Memorial Park. This was their second matchup against the Dukes this season.

The Hokies’ next game is scheduled for Friday, March 14 at 6 p.m. at Doak Field at Dail Park against North Carolina State Wolfpack.
